Output 03b66c28f842e3a951569b7daa4f6df102e3400f08373119873875e4aa01bbe2:1

value
49544398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3749cf3c2132bb8bef5f04ade001094e7ffbb OP_EQUAL
address
3BMEXGjLA42BxrK4CQ94NWYo8jr2KqcrqM
transaction
03b66c28f842e3a951569b7daa4f6df102e3400f08373119873875e4aa01bbe2
confirmations
352293
spent
true